DanH wrote: View PostYou are not obligated to sign your pick. But if you don't, and they don't sign with a pro team somewhere, you lose your rights after a year. A pick signing with any pro team stops the clock on losing their rights.
Same applies for second round picks. If they aren't playing pro, you lose their rights.
As for the D-League, D-League teams cannot sign players outright. Any non-NBA roster player who wants to play in the D-League has to go through the D-League draft. The exception is that each team can assign up to two players who are invited to camp but do not make the roster directly to their D-League team without going through the draft. But only two. So no, you can't just draft a dozen second rounders and stack your D-League team - at best you can control 5 exclusive D-League entities, 3 with inactive roster spots and two with camp invite assignees.
